Nova Launcher has custom resizable grids, custom scrollable dock, and a host of animations and is very fast.
But the reason I can't live without it is gesture support. I can double up every icon with two functions depending on tap or swipe up. I can do this on any icon, any folder (tap opens the folder, swipe up opens the most used app in the folder), and even the icons within the folders. I can pull down the shade from a swipe down motion from anywhere on the screen instead of reaching for it. Through the use of swipes, folders, and a resized grid, I have every shortcut I need on a single screen. I only scroll to the other screens for widgets.

Gesture nagivation + 3rd party launchers BUGGY MESS - any way to fix?

I know gesture navigation in 3rd party launchers is suppose to work on oneui 2.5 on note 20 ultra. But it doesn't work very well at all.
1. Swiping up to get to recent apps is not a very smooth animation, but worse is that the current app gets positioned in the middle rather than to the right, so quick switching is cumbersome.
2. Trying to use the swipe right on the bottom for previous app is a buggy mess. It's unsmooth and pops in the recent view briefly. Often you get stuck and cannot use the app you switched to, needing to swipe back and switch back and forth to get normal operation again. After trying to use these swipe right/left gestures to quick switch apps, you cannot scroll through the recent apps view quicky anymore, one swipe always mean moving one app to the left or right no matter how strong the swipe. This stays until rebooting.
It's a buggy mess, is there any way to fix this? I'm using Nova, but the problems are the same on all 3rd party launchers.
